## Break-Glass: Ladleworks Recipe Scaler

If the Ladleworks scaling calculator starts returning corrupted ratios in production and the normal deploy pipeline is down, use break-glass access to roll back directly. This bypasses review, so it is logged and reviewed afterward — use it only when customer recipes are actively broken. The rollback console is sealed; it opens only with the recovery passphrase written just below.

unlock words, hahip-baduf: holwyn-istath-julvan

Escalation: Zero-Downtime Schema Migrations

If a Driftwell migration stalls beyond ten minutes, do not cancel it manually; the dual-write shim must be torn down in order. First page the secondary on-call, then freeze deploys via the Harborline console. Record timestamps for every step in the incident doc. If the shim desyncs, escalate immediately to the migrations lead at the address below.

escalation mailbox, bafog-fafog: ulador@paliqlabs.internal

**Ticket: SEC-881 — Prod credential found in staging env**

Hey — while poking at the WashPoint locker service on staging, I noticed the door-unlock credential there is the production one. Oops. We've rotated it and staging now needs its own. Whoever applies the fix: edit the staging `.env` and replace the old entry with this line:

sealed setting: ARCHIVE_KEY3=8d0